> From: John R Fortiner <pianoserv440@juno.com> > > What is/are your favorite methods/tool(s) for enlarging the recess that > castors fit into on the bottom of pianos such as when fitting double > wheel castors so the arm of the castor doesn't get hung up against the > existing recess? > I've used chisels and rotary files chucked into a drill for this - bad > wording - I never chucked the chisels into a drill :-), but feel there > has to be a better way. > > John Fortiner > Billings, MT. I take my router with me... I put an old sheet out to catch the dust/shavings etc. Quick, very neat and easy... but noisy! Take your preferred ear protection with you!
